Introduction

Arterial blood gas (ABG) collection plays a crucial role in medical laboratory and phlebotomy practice in the United States. It is a valuable diagnostic tool that provides valuable information about a patient's respiratory and metabolic status. However, like any medical procedure, there are potential complications associated with ABG collection that healthcare professionals must be aware of in order to ensure patient safety and accurate Test Results.

Incorrect technique

One of the most common complications associated with ABG collection is incorrect technique. Proper training and skill are required to ensure that the sample is collected correctly and accurately. If the needle is inserted too deeply or not at the correct angle, it can result in the collection of contaminated or inadequate samples, leading to inaccurate Test Results.

Risk of infection or injury

Another complication that can arise from ABG collection is the risk of infection or injury. If the procedure is not done according to standard protocols, there is a possibility of introducing bacterial contamination or causing damage to the artery or surrounding tissues. This can not only compromise the safety of the patient but also lead to further medical complications that may require additional treatment.

Potential for patient discomfort

ABG collection can be a painful and distressing procedure for patients, especially if they are already in a vulnerable or critical condition. The puncture of the artery can cause discomfort and anxiety, and if the procedure is not performed quickly and efficiently, it can prolong the patient's discomfort and distress. It is essential for healthcare professionals to provide proper care and support to patients undergoing ABG collection to minimize their discomfort and ensure their well-being.
